Core Mechanisms: How It Works
At its core, the net worth method compares an individual’s or entity’s financial position at two points in time: before and after suspected misconduct. The difference between the two is presumed to represent illicit gains. However, this linear approach fails when fraudsters employ circular transactions—moving funds between accounts, entities, or jurisdictions to reset the "before" baseline. For instance, a corrupt official might embezzle public funds, then "repay" the embezzled amount from a personal account to maintain a stable net worth on paper.
The method’s reliance on documented transactions also ignores the timing of asset acquisition. A fraudster could sell a high-value asset (like a yacht) just before an investigation begins, then repurchase it later under a different name. The net worth method can tend to understat the amount of stolen fund in such cases because it treats the asset as "disposed of" rather than recognizing the underlying wealth transfer. This is why forensic teams now supplement net worth analysis with cash flow tracing and behavioral analytics—tools that reveal patterns the static method misses.

Major Advantages
- Legal Admissibility: Net worth calculations are widely accepted in courts due to their structured, document-based approach, making them easier to defend in litigation.
- Cost-Effectiveness: Compared to alternative methods (like predictive modeling or AI-driven analytics), net worth analysis requires fewer resources and shorter timelines.
- Transparency: The method’s reliance on public records (tax returns, property deeds) provides a paper trail that can be scrutinized by multiple parties.
- Baseline Establishment: It offers a starting point for further investigation, even if initial estimates are conservative.
- Regulatory Compliance: Many jurisdictions mandate net worth disclosures in financial crime cases, ensuring consistency across investigations.

Comprehensive FAQs
Q: Can the net worth method ever accurately reflect stolen funds?
A: Only in cases where the fraudster’s assets are fully documented and no offshore or intangible wealth exists. Even then, timing discrepancies (e.g., selling assets pre-investigation) can skew results. For accurate recovery, it must be paired with cash flow tracing and asset mapping.
Q: Why do fraudsters prefer methods that make the net worth method understat the amount of stolen fund?
A: Because the method relies on visible, reportable assets. Fraudsters exploit this by converting funds into cash, cryptocurrency, or undervalued assets (e.g., art, real estate). Offshore accounts and shell companies further obscure true wealth, ensuring the net worth calculation remains artificially low.
Q: Are there industries where this method works better than others?
A: Yes. It’s most effective in sectors with transparent financial records (e.g., banking, publicly traded companies) and least reliable in industries with high cash flow (e.g., retail, hospitality) or complex supply chains (e.g., manufacturing). Cryptocurrency and private equity are particularly risky due to their opacity.
Q: How can investigators mitigate the risk of underreporting?
A: By supplementing net worth analysis with:
- Blockchain forensics for crypto-linked fraud.
- Beneficial ownership searches for shell companies.
- Behavioral analytics to detect unusual spending patterns.
- Collaboration with international financial intelligence units (FIUs).
- Expert witnesses specializing in asset concealment tactics.
